Diatom biostratigraphy and datum events of ODP Hole 183-1140A

DOI

Ocean Drilling Program (ODP) Leg 183 Site 1140 provided a lower Oligocene to middle Miocene record of diatom assemblages from the northern Kerguelen Plateau. Samples were examined to improve the resolution of shipboard diatom biostratigraphy. The material is complementary to that recovered during ODP Legs 119 and 120, and the diatom zonation of Harwood and Maruyama could be readily applied. A standard succession of biostratigraphic zones from the middle Miocene and lower Oligocene was delineated, although some zones were unrecognizable because of poor core recovery. The detailed diatom biostratigraphy presented here agrees well with shipboard calcareous nannofossil biostratigraphy. Sediment accumulation rates based on diatom bioevents average 1.26 cm/k.y.
